For the 2026 school year, there are 4 public schools serving 2,797 students in 79765, TX.
The top-ranked public schools in 79765, TX are Idea Yukon College Preparatory and Compass Academy Charter School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public schools in zipcode 79765 have an average math proficiency score of 44% (versus the Texas public school average of 44%), and reading proficiency score of 55% (versus the 51% statewide average). Schools in 79765, TX have an average ranking of 7/10, which is in the top 50% of Texas public schools.
Minority enrollment is 58%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Texas public school average of 76% (majority Hispanic).
